Mépriser l’autre c’est se croire supérieur, ne plus respecter son humanité et sa dignité. Donc perdre la sienne, mourir spirituellement. Les bas instincts d’un ego hypertrophié dominent, la conscience part.
« Les premiers seront les derniers ».

Né en 1951 à Royan, au bord de l'océan, l'auteur grandit en toute liberté, nourrissant très tôt une soif de spiritualité. ionné par la sagesse et les religions, il explore ces thématiques à travers ses lectures, tout en développant un amour profond pour la peinture. Bien que ses études d’ingénieur et ses obligations professionnelles l’éloignent du pinceau, l’appel de l’art demeure. À 58 ans, il décide de s’y consacrer pleinement et ouvre son premier atelier en 2014 à Aigrefeuille. Suivent d’autres lieux de création à Mortagne-sur-Gironde puis à Vallières en 2021. Ses œuvres, numérotées chronologiquement, témoignent d’un voyage intérieur, chaque tableau étant un fragment de réflexion et d’énergie bienfaisante. À travers la peinture, il façonne un langage vibrant entre spiritualité et expression artistique, offrant à chacun une porte ouverte vers l’émotion et la contemplation.
